Introduction to Calcium Carbide

Calcium carbide is produced through the reaction of lime and coke at high temperatures in an electric arc furnace. This process is energy-intensive and requires careful control of raw material quality and furnace conditions to achieve optimal yields.

Applications of Calcium Carbide

1. Acetylene Production: Calcium carbide reacts with water to produce acetylene gas, which is used in welding, cutting, and as a raw material for various chemicals.

CaC₂ + 2H₂O → C₂H₂ + Ca(OH)₂

2. Steel Production: It is used as a desulfurizing agent in steelmaking to improve the quality of steel by reducing sulfur content.

3. Chemical Synthesis: Calcium carbide is a precursor for calcium cyanamide, a nitrogenous fertilizer.

Current State of Calcium Carbide Production in India

In fiscal year 2023, India's calcium carbide production volume was approximately 83,440 metric tons. The Indian chemical industry is highly diversified, producing over 80,000 different products. However, the sector faces challenges such as fluctuating raw material costs, infrastructure limitations, and environmental regulations.

Challenges in the Indian Market

- Raw Material Costs: Fluctuations in the prices of limestone and coke, the primary raw materials, affect production costs.

- Infrastructure and Logistics: Limited infrastructure and high transportation costs can hinder supply chain efficiency.

- Environmental Concerns: The production process is energy-intensive and generates significant carbon emissions, prompting calls for sustainable practices.

Future Trends in Calcium Carbide Production

Technological Advancements

1. Energy Efficiency: Improvements in furnace design and energy management systems can reduce energy consumption and lower emissions.

2. Alternative Raw Materials: Research into using biomass or other sustainable materials could reduce carbon footprints.

3. Digitalization and Automation: Implementing advanced automation and digital technologies can enhance operational efficiency and reduce labor costs.

Market Demand

1. Growing Construction Sector: Increased demand for PVC and other construction materials will drive calcium carbide consumption.

2. Steel Industry Expansion: The need for high-quality steel in infrastructure projects will boost demand for calcium carbide as a desulfurizing agent.

3. Emerging Chemical Applications: New chemical synthesis pathways may open up additional markets for calcium carbide.

Environmental and Regulatory Considerations

1. Sustainability Initiatives: Implementing green technologies and reducing waste will become more critical as environmental regulations tighten.

2. Regulatory Frameworks: Compliance with stricter environmental standards will influence production practices and costs.

3. Carbon Pricing and Emissions Trading: As India moves towards a more carbon-neutral economy, producers may need to adapt to carbon pricing mechanisms.
